Economic growth in developing regions often relies on international commerce and foreign investment, yet these drivers can bring environmental costs. An investigation into five North African countries between 1990 and 2014 assesses how income, energy use, trade, and foreign direct investment affect carbon dioxide emissions, accounting for spatial dependency. The findings confirm the Environmental Kuznets Curve hypothesis, showing that all five nations remain in the initial phase where economic expansion increases environmental damage. Furthermore, domestic exports reduce local carbon dioxide emissions but produce positive spillover emissions in neighbouring countries. Conversely, imports and trade openness increase local emissions while generating negative spillovers across borders. Foreign direct investment shows no discernible influence on carbon emissions. Consequently, regional policymakers need to account for the cross-border environmental impacts of trade, economic growth, and energy consumption when designing national policies.
Cross-border economic relationships directly influence environmental quality in North Africa. Because national trade and energy decisions generate spillover effects into neighbouring states, individual countries cannot tackle decarbonisation in isolation. Understanding how trade flows and growth affect regional carbon footprints helps policymakers design coordinated economic and environmental strategies that prevent economic expansion from triggering unchecked degradation.

Developing countries depend on international trade and Foreign Direct Investment (FDI) to support their economies. However, these activities should not be to the extent, that their adverse environmental effects get ignored. The present study aims at exploring the impact of income, trade, energy consumption, and FDI on CO2 emissions in five North African countries from 1990 to 2014. The analysis also probes the Environmental Kuznets Curve (EKC) hypothesis, considering spatial dependency in the model. We find a significant spatial dependency in the model and validate the presence of the EKC hypothesis as well. All investigated countries are found in the first phase of EKC, which explains the negative environmental consequences of economic growth. Further, we establish evidence of the negative effect of exports on CO2 emissions while their spillover effects on the neighboring countries are found positive. The effects of imports and total trade openness are found positive on local economies, and their spillovers are negative. FDI is not found to be affecting CO2 emissions. We recommend the North African countries to keep the environmental consequences of energy consumption, economic growth, and imports in check while formulating energy, trade, and public policies.
